10up / http
此包已被废弃且不再维护。没有建议的替代包。
HTTP头部包装器。
1.0.0
2014-10-30 03:59 UTC
Requires (Dev)
- 10up/wp_mock: dev-master
- antecedent/patchwork: 1.2.*
- brianium/paratest: dev-master
- phpunit/phpunit: *@stable
This package is auto-updated.
Last update: 2023-07-18 15:33:25 UTC
README
HTTP头部包装器。
目的
此库的目标是提供一个针对PHP默认header()
接口的测试就绪替代方案。您可以通过此库将头部信息添加到PHP中,而不是直接发送头部信息。此外,您还可以轻松地在自己的项目中模拟此库,以完全解耦代码与PHP原语。
安装
您可以通过将10up/http
添加到composer.json
文件中轻松安装此模块。然后,要么自动加载Composer依赖项,要么手动包含HTTP.php
引导文件。
使用
与其直接调用PHP的header()
方法,您只需调用\TenUp\HTTP\v1_0_0\add()
来添加新头部。这允许您指定键、值,以及是否要覆盖现有值。
当WordPress调用其常规的send_headers
操作时,系统加载的所有头部信息都将发送到浏览器;您不需要在自己的代码中做任何其他工作。
变更日志
1.0
- 首次公开发布